veru
Meaning
- (declension-4) spit, broach (especially for roasting)
- (declension-4) dart, javelin
- (declension-4, in-plural) paling or railing around an altar or tomb
- (declension-4) a critical sign on the margin of a book, obelus

Pronounced as (IPA)
[ˈwɛ.ruː]
Etymology
From Proto-Italic *gʷeru (“spit”), from Proto-Indo-European *gʷéru.
